I have worked with titanium making a chefs knife. While it resists grinding with any high speed abrasive operation...it files easily. To reduce costs of belts, profile blade with a file and finish with belts. Job well done guys.I enjoyed the video.

Don't get me wrong, what they have done was awesome. But they are missing a couple of things.
1. the blade is coated in silver.
2. the handle blade mechanism isn't manually activated. It activates when someone grabs the sword. When the "key" rotates to the right position, then blade pushes it into a locking position PREVENTING the blades from popping out. It's a defense mechanism.
